X5 Questions before buying

My dealer has an X5 4.8is Black/Black w/ everything, I contemplating buying it and I was wondering if anyone with an '02/'03/'04 4.6is has had many (if any) problems.

The only issue i have run into at just over 50k is I had a faulty door a lock (which is common I’m told), and while under warranty BMW replaced an oil temp sensor. Besides that it’s a fabulous vehicle.

Great to see that you’re looking at a fine and respectable car. I recently had the same dilemma too. My BM dealer also had a 3.0 diesel. I ended up purchasing the diesel as it goes like a rocket and costs hardly anything to run. I'm nearly getting 10.2Litres/100Kms. (Nearly 30MPG)

My friendly dealer lent me an X5 4.4 for a week. She drank double the fuel.

I think I've made the right choice getting the diesel. Especially with the high fuel prices we have in Aus. I only have to visit the gas station twice a month opposed to 4 or 5 times.
